Animal Care Technician II

JOB DESCRIPTION: Performs routine and specialized duties associated with animal care, including feeding, medicating, cleaning, restraint and transportation. Maintains adequate inventory of necessary supplies and equipment. Observes animal behavior and conditions, collects specimens and provides technical assistance to research and veterinary personnel. Performs minor repairs and maintains animal housing facility. May train and supervise new technicians. May drive utility vehicles to transport animals and supplies, ensuring safe operation, daily inspection and vehicle cleanliness. Performs related responsibilities as required. Employees in this classification may be required to work with, take specific precautions against and/or be immunized against potentially hazardous agents.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:
A high school diploma or equivalent and two years of animal husbandry/care experience OR certification as Assistant Laboratory Animal Technician (ALAT) and two years of animal husbandry/care experience OR four years of animal husbandry/care experience. The ability to lift up to 50 pounds. Positions within this classification may require a valid Georgia driver's license and an insurable driving record. Positions in this classification may require three years of transportation and routing experience in lieu of animal husbandry/care experience.
